Anybody have any experience with one? I prefer aperture sights, but don't really like the skinner dovetail sight I have on the barrel of my papoose. I think it is too far from my eye. I don't think I will like the Marbles for the same reason, but the design is so much different than a normal peep sight. I am leaning towards williams firesights, but figured I would see if anyone here had good luck with the marbles. It will be going on my Marlin 30tk. Its got a low mounted scope in weaver rings. I want to be able to remove the scope and shoot irons sometimes.
Posted By: mannyspd1 Re: Marbles bulls eye sight - 06/08/21
I have one on a Rossi pump .22. It works ok for my eyes, not as accurate as a peep mounted on the rear receiver or tang, but better sight picture than regular open sights.

For the money, buy it, try it, and if tou dont like it you are not out that much $.
